Darryl F. Zanuck, one of Hollywood's towering figures for almost half a century, presided over Twentieth Century Fox during its most glorious era. These were the golden days when stars like Marilyn Monroe, Henry Fonda, Betty Grable, Gregory Peck and even Bette Davis roamed the lot; when such giants as John Ford, Elia Kazan and Otto Preminger ruled the sets; and when such blockbusters as The Grapes of Wrath, All About Eve, Miracle on 34th Street and The King and I filled the screen. Rudy Behlmer presents a from-the-top, at-the-moment, insider's look at the myriad elements that went into the production of a feature film during the colorful days of the old studio system, from the man who pulled it all together. Memo from Darryl F. Zanuck, a treasure trove of legend and lore, insights and nostalgia, is as entertaining as it is informative and full of secrets and surprises.
